G

GitLab Flowとは? GitLabによって提案されたブランチ戦略

1.GitLab Flow GitLab Flowは、GitLabによって提案されたブランチ戦略で、GitFlowとGitHub Flowの特徴を組み合わせたシンプルかつ柔軟な方法です。GitLab Flowでは、継続的なデプロイメント環境...
G

GitHub Flowとは? シンプルで効率的なGitのブランチ戦略

1.GitHub Flowとは? GitHub Flowは、シンプルで効率的なGitのブランチ戦略です。開発プロセスを単純化し、迅速なデプロイを可能にすることを目的としています。GitHub Flowでは、以下の手順に従って開発が進められま...
G

Gitflowとは? Gitのブランチ管理戦略の一つ

1.Gitflowとは? Gitflowは、ソフトウェア開発プロジェクトでのGitのブランチ管理戦略の一つです。Vincent Driessenによって提案され、コードベースの管理とリリースのプロセスを効率的に行うことを目的としています。G...

ブランチ戦略とは? ブランチをどのように使用し、管理し、組織するか

ブランチ戦略とは? ブランチ戦略とは、ソフトウェア開発プロジェクトにおいて、バージョン管理システム(Gitなど)のブランチをどのように使用し、管理し、組織するかに関する方針や手順のことです。ブランチ戦略は、コードの品質、開発効率、チームの協...
A

Argoとは? Kubernetes用のワークフロー管理ツール

Argoとは何かを詳細に解説!Kubernetesのための効率的なワークフロー管理ツールを使いこなそう。
A

Airflowとは? タスクのスケジューリングとモニタリング

1.簡単に説明すると データのワークフローを自動化するツールである。 タスクの実行順序や間隔を設定可能である。 Pythonでワークフローを定義することができる。 2. 詳細に説明すると Apache Airflowは、タスクのスケジューリ...
A

ACID特性とは? データベースが持つべき4つの特性

1.簡単に説明すると データベースが持つべき4つの特性 トランザクションの安全性を確保 矛盾なくデータ操作を行うための基準 2. 詳細に説明すると ACID特性とは、データベースのトランザクションが持つべき4つの基本的な特性を指します。これ...
H

HDFSとは? ビッグデータを扱うための分散ファイルシステム

1. 簡単に説明すると ビッグデータを扱うための分散ファイルシステム 大量のデータを複数のマシンに分散して保管 システムの信頼性を確保するための冗長化が特徴 2. 詳細に説明すると HDFSとは、Hadoop Distributed Fil...
M

MapReduceとは? 大量のデータを分散処理する技術

1. 簡単に説明すると MapReduceは、大量のデータを分散処理する技術の一つである。 二つの主要なステップ、「Map」と「Reduce」から構成されている。 これにより、計算量が多いタスクでも、多数のマシンで並列に処理することができる...
H

Hadoopとは? ビッグデータ処理を行うためのOSS

1. 簡単に説明すると ビッグデータの処理を行うためのオープンソースソフトウェア 分散型ファイルシステムを利用し、大量データの保存と処理が可能 MapReduceという計算モデルを用いる 2. 詳細に説明すると Hadoopは、大量のデータ...